EU ministers to discuss bolstering naval mission in Middle East, extend to Strait of Hormuz
The EU’s Aspides mission was established in 2024 to protect ships from attacks by Yemen’s Houthi rebel group in the Red Sea. It currently has an Italian and a Greek ship under its direct command.
